Transaction 576537ad3b155a587951d1f3d1090722a260ce37c62b807c5b331bd458cd714a

2 Input
2 Outputs
  • 576537ad3b155a587951d1f3d1090722a260ce37c62b807c5b331bd458cd714a:0
  • value  587923
    address  15HvyhKL5ikML4mz4dCyjqWk8TSQEPpJum
  • 576537ad3b155a587951d1f3d1090722a260ce37c62b807c5b331bd458cd714a:1
  • value  2405975
    address  38kG9aM2DuGK4D2Xh4jGJH4FvvBDzkucVr